    Abstract

    This paper aims to do three things: first, to identify the essential principles of good practice in the field of youth justice; second, to provide a brief critical overview of the current state of youth justice policy in Wales, in terms of both the content and framework within which it is developed and delivered; and, finally, to consider a set of practical measures designed to make Welsh communities safer by helping our young people integrate and participate in them more fully.
